Unit 10 Basic Nursing Skills Ppt 3. conflict resolution. at some point in your nursing career, you will have to resolve a conflict. that conflict may be between you and a co worker or a patient and a family member. regardless, you need to have the ability to handle conflicts in a healthy way, so that the outcome is positive for all involved.
